Finding the Holy Grail: The Perfect PDF
So, where do you find these mythical creatures, these Préhistoire evaluation PDFs with correction? Well, here's the down-low based on my (ongoing) research:

- Google (Duh!): Obvious, I know, but use specific keywords. "Evaluation Prehistoire 6eme corrigé," "Test Prehistoire 6eme PDF correction," try all variations. Don't be afraid to dig deep.
- Teachers' Forums: Sometimes teachers share resources on online forums. It's worth checking if any of your teacher’s colleagues might have uploaded something usable. (Though, be discreet!)
- Online Educational Platforms: Sites like Le Figaro Etudiant or similar, sometimes host or link to resources for different subjects, including 6ème Préhistoire. Look for the "ressources" or "téléchargements" sections.
- Ask Around: Talk to other parents! Someone’s bound to have a file lurking on their hard drive from an older sibling. Sharing is caring, people!
Pro Tip: When you find a potential PDF, always double-check the correction. Errors can happen! You don't want your kid memorizing the wrong answers. Imagine the embarrassment! "But Auntie said the Cro-Magnons used iPhones!"
